浙江道地药材杭白菊总黄酮纯化工艺研究  被引量:1

Purification Technology of Total Flavone in White Chrysanthemum of Zhejiang Genuine Medicinal Material

在线阅读下载全文

作  者:俞栩喆 

机构地区:[1]嵊州市中医院中药房,浙江嵊州312400

出  处:《中华中医药学刊》2013年第9期2059-2061,共3页Chinese Archives of Traditional Chinese Medicine

摘  要:目的:研究大孔树脂纯化杭白菊总黄酮的最佳工艺条件。方法:以静态吸附量、解析率为指标,考察5种大孔树脂对杭白菊总黄酮的纯化能力;以总黄酮的转移率和纯度为指标,对AB-8大孔树脂的上样量、水洗脱量、洗脱溶剂、洗脱体积进行考察。结果:AB-8树脂具有最佳的吸附性能,最佳工艺为2BV杭白菊总黄酮提取液上样,0.5BV/h的流速进行动态吸附,4BV蒸馏水洗脱,3BV 60%乙醇洗脱。结论:AB-8大孔树脂性能好,可用于纯化杭白菊中的总黄酮。Objective: To study the optimal conditions of macroporous resin purification of flavonoids in Chrysanthe- mum morifolium. Method:Static adsorption and desorption rate as indexes, 5 kinds of maeroporous resin were inspected for purification of flavones from chrysanthemum;the transferred rate and the purity of AB -8 index, macroporous resin, water washing sample volume, solvent volume, elution volume were inspeced. Results:AB -8 resin has the best adsorp- tion performance, optimal process was 2 BV chrysanthemum total flavone extract sample ,0.5BV/h flow rate for dynamic adsorption, elution of 4BV of distilled water,3BV 60% ethanol elution. Conclusion:AB -8 maeroporous resin perform- ance can be used for the purification of chrysanthemum total flavone.
